Kathleen Romanow

Associate

Kathleen "Kate" Romanow joined the firm in January 2007. She comes to PPSV from Reed Smith, where she worked in the health practice on a wide range of Medicare and Medicaid reimbursement, fraud and abuse and other regulatory matters.  Kate came to Washington after first working for firms in Albany, New York and Honolulu, Hawaii. She is a graduate of the State University of New York at Genesee with both a BS and MA in Speech Pathology.  Kate worked for three years as a licensed speech pathologist in both school and healthcare settings before attending Boston University School of Law.  She graduated from BU in 2002 with honors and a Health Law concentration. At BU, she was an Editor of the American Journal of Law and Medicine.
